Several Bafana Bafana fans have been writing obituaries for Percy Tau after an underwhelming Afcon for the Lion of Judah. There could be a way back though, if he leaves Al Ahly.


TAU REACHES AL AHLY CROSSROADS

Percy Tau is reportedly up for sale according to SoccerLaduma. That is via Sport.Elwatannews, believes the 29-year-old wide attacker is surplus to requirements at Al Ahly. The aforementioned Egyptian outlet mentions that Tau, Malian midfielder Aliou Dieng and Tunisian star Dhaoui Cristo, three of the club’s foreign stars, will be sold to free up funds. Tau has one year left on his current deal, so Al Ahly will need to act fast by selling now or pinning him down to extended terms. The former options seem likelier at this juncture.

Tau is still a key player for Bafana Bafana who reached the semi-finals of Afcon. However, he did draw criticism for his profligacy in front of goal. If he can secure a move back to South Africa and the DStv Premiership, it could pave the way for a smoother potential redemption arc.

YOUNG, DYNAMIC FORWARDS WAITING IN THE WINGS

South Africa’s forward line needs more dynamism and directness. Mihlali Mayambela showed his raw pace and power off the bench, while Bongokuhle Hlongwane, prolific in the MLS, wasn’t included in Hugo Broos’ Afcon squad. Both could lay a viable claim to starting berths for Bafana for years to come. Orlando Pirates man Evidence Makopa showed he has the raw ingredients to make it work as the number 9, so it’s all about finding wide players who can thrive around a focal point striker. Tau, formerly of Sundowns, Brighton, Club Brugge and Anderlecht, will be 30 in May. He can still contribute vital experience and know-how to the Bafana cause, but he might need to move closer to home to facilitate it.

Tau was not named in the Bafana’s most recent squad to take on Andorra and Algeria in friendly matches.

‘I talked to him and he said it was not a problem but I knew it was a problem,’ said the Bafana head coach, who wants to protect Tau from further criticism back home.
